Is one Life really enough for Genealogists?

Genealogists in the Second Life (SL) virtual world now have a powerful new tool for conducting research within the realms of this interactive social networking environment. We released the first general release version of the Live Roots Genealogy HUD. HUD stands for Heads up display, and is type of object that can be worn, functions like a control panel, but cannot seen by other residents. The Genealogy HUD functions in parallel to the LiveRoots.com website; SL residents may Search, Navigate and Discover genealogy resources in a similar manner. The Genealogy HUD is available for free in the Live Roots Genealogy Zone (within Second Life). A single Basic account to Second Life is also FREE.
